Job description

The Business Process Analyst (BPA) supports OSDHโ€™s Transformation Management Office (TMO) in analyzing, documenting, and improving agency business processes. The BPA will apply business process analysis and Lean Six Sigma methodologies to identify inefficiencies, streamline workflows, and develop sustainable process improvements. The contractor will also provide high-quality process documentation, including process maps, standard operating procedures (SOPs), analysis reports, and recommendations, to support operational effectiveness, quality improvement, and agency transformation priorities.

Duties include, but are not limited to:

-Conduct business process analysis through stakeholder interviews, workflow reviews, data analysis, and other appropriate assessment methods.

-Develop and maintain current-state and future-state process maps, workflows, and supporting documentation.

-Apply Lean Six Sigma and quality improvement methodologies to identify process gaps, bottlenecks, redundancies, root causes, and improvement opportunities.

-Develop practical, data-informed recommendations to improve process efficiency, effectiveness, standardization, and sustainability.

-Develop and revise standard operating procedures (SOPs), process documentation, business requirements, reports, executive summaries, and other written materials.

-Facilitate or support process improvement sessions with program staff, subject matter experts, and other stakeholders.

-Develop appropriate process measures and performance indicators to evaluate the effectiveness of implemented improvements.

-Support implementation, change management, and sustainment activities associated with approved process improvements.

-Provide regular progress updates and maintain documentation of assigned projects, deliverables, risks, issues, and recommendations.

-Complete assigned deliverables within established timelines and incorporate OSDH feedback into final work products. -Completes other duties, as assigned.
